Patent attributes
Embodiments of the invention provide methods and apparatus for modifying a spatial index in response to movements of a predictably dynamic object within a three-dimensional scene. According to one embodiment of the invention, in contrast to generating a new spatial index in response to movement of a predictably dynamic object, a portion of an existing spatial index may be modified in response to the movement of a predictably dynamic object. According to one embodiment of the invention, modification may include changing information defining the position of splitting planes along a splitting axis to correspond to the new position of the object within the three-dimensional scene. In contrast to generating a new spatial index, by modifying only a portion of an existing spatial index the amount of time required to perform ray tracing image processing may be reduced.